Chewy is seeking a Sr. Data Engineer III in Boston. This person will be part of the Rx Data Science team responsible for building a prescription data platform in support of Pharmacy Operations. The ideal candidate will have an interest in building data pipelines, an eye for data quality, and excel in a fast-paced environment. Additionally, the candidate will have a strong customer first attitude, embody a curious and think big approach to their work to help further innovation within the team, and be an engaged and encouraging team member.

What You'll Do:

  • Develop and maintain sophisticated data ingestion pipelines and transformations for data originating from multiple data sources (structured/unstructured)
  • Assist in crafting proof of concepts and advise, consult, mentor, and coach other data engineering and analytics professionals on data standards
  • Data cataloging and documentation of data sources
  • Oversee data pipelines for accuracy, missing data, improvements, changes, and billing volumes to ensure all data is assembled and processed accurately and when needed
  • Build containerized applications with microservices architecture
  • Reconcile data issues and alerts between various systems, finding opportunities to innovate and drive improvements. Work with multi-functional partners in defining and documenting requirements for building high-quality and impactful data products
  • Create operational reports using visualization/business intelligence tools

What You'll Need:

  • 8+ years of proven experience in Data Engineering or Business Analytics roles working with ETL, Data Modeling, and Data Architecture, developing modern data pipelines and applications
  • Expertise crafting and implementing enterprise data pipelines using data engineering approaches and tools including but not limited to: Spark, PySpark, Scala, Docker, Databricks, Glue, cloud-native EDW (Snowflake, Redshift), Kafka, Athena
  • Strong dimensional data modeling (Star, Snowflake) and ER modeling skills! Proficiency building and maintaining infrastructure-as-code preferably with terraform and AWS ecosystem
  • Proficiency in Java, Python, SQL
  • Experience with writing and reviewing version-controlled code (GitHub) 
  • Experience effectively presenting insights and summarizing sophisticated data to diverse audiences through visualizations
  • To be a self-starter with the ability to take initiative and drive projects forward independently. Experience working with and delivering to collaborators from multiple parts of the company
